"Embracing a Healthier Lifestyle: The Keto Diet"

"The ketogenic ("keto") diet has become quite popular in the last couple of years as a result of its proven ability to support fat reduction .

At its core , the keto diet means reducing your carbohydrate intake and upping intake of fats. This shift in eating habits prompts your body into a metabolic state known as ketogenesis.

During the state of ketosis, your body begins to burn fat for energy, instead of relying on carbohydrates. This leads to weight loss, boosted energy levels, and could also improve various health conditions.

Bear in mind that the ketogenic diet should be applied carefully . Like any diet, it might not work for everyone, and it can have potential side effects. These might involve minor concerns such as headache, fatigue and irritability in the initial phase of the diet. These symptoms often fade after the body adjusts to the new diet.

However, before making a drastic change to your diet, it is crucial to consult with a healthcare professional or nutritionist. They can provide you with guidance on how to implement the diet safely and ensure that you are getting the right nutrients for your individual needs.

Furthermore, it's recommended to couple the keto diet with a regular exercise routine. Getting involved in physical activity could help accentuate the weight loss and other potential health benefits of the keto diet.
